Salve ragazzi,
il problema è questo. Nel tag "title" della home page relativamente al mio sito vi sono delle funzioni php che richiamano i dati del sito stesso (come nome, descrizione, ecc. Quelli che poi vengono utilizzati per il SEO e quindi indicizzazione). Quando però viene processata la homepage nel codice sorgente (il sito è già indicizzato) al posto del nome compare tra i due tag "title" l'URL (ad esempio www.esempio.com) e non il titolo che vorrei dargli (nel caso in oggetto dovrebbe uscire solo "esempio" senza www e com). Quindi su google esce "www.esempio.com" e non "esempio". Come mai?

Vi posto il pezzo di codice incriminato


Codice PHP:
<title> 
<?php if(is_home() ) { bloginfo('name'); ?> | <?php bloginfo('description'); } ?> <?php if(is_single() || is_page() || is_archive() || is_tag() || is_category() ) { wp_title('',true); ?> | <?php bloginfo('name'); } ?> <?php if(is_404()) { ?> <?php _e('404 Error! Page Not Found','WpAdvNewspaper'); ?> | <?php bloginfo('name'); } ?> <?php if(is_search()) { ?><?php _e('Search results for:','WpAdvNewspaper'); ?> <?php echo wp_specialchars($s1); ?> | <?php bloginfo('name'); } ?> 
</title>